	body{
		margin:0;
		background-color:#ffffff;
		color:#666666;
	}
	a:link {
		color:#666666;
	}		
	a:visited {
		color:#666666;
	}	
	a:hover {
		color:#628eb1;
	}		
	a:active {
		color:#628eb1;
	}		
	p{
		font-family:Verdana, Geneva, Arial, Helvetica, sans-serif;
		font-size:10pt;
		text-align:left;
		text-indent:2em;
		color:#000000;
	}	
	img{border:0;}
	ul{
		font-family:Verdana, Geneva, Arial, Helvetica, sans-serif;
		font-size:10pt;
		text-align:left;
		color:#000000;
		list-style-type:square;
	}

	/***************CONTENT***********************/
	.divMain{  
		position:absolute;
		top:315px;
		left:0;
		width:600px;
		z-index:0;
		padding-left:10px;
		padding-top:10px;
		color:#000000;
	}
	/***************RIGHT CONTENT***********************/
	.divRight{
		position:absolute;;
		top:315px;
		left:650px;
		width:300px;
		z-index:0;
		padding:20px;
	}
	/***************************TOP****************************************/
	.divLogo{
		position:absolute;
		top: 0;
		left:0;
		height:170px;
		padding-left:20px;
		padding-top:20px;
		padding-bottom:20px;
		z-index:0;
	}
	.divTopRight{
		position:absolute;
		top:0;
		right:0px;
		height:231px;
		z-index:100;
		}
	.divTop{
		position:absolute;
		top:170px;
		left:0;
		height:99px;
		width:1000px;
		padding:0px;
		margin:0px;
		border-top-style:groove;
		border-top-width:1px;
		border-top-color:#bcbec0;
		border-bottom-style:groove;
		border-bottom-width:1px;
		border-bottom-color:#bcbec0;
		z-index:0;				
		}
	.divAddr{
		position:absolute;
		top:5px;
		right:350px;
		z-index:100;
		text-align:right;				
		}
	.spanAddr{
		font-family:Verdana, Geneva, Arial, Helvetica, sans-serif;
		font-size:10pt;
		font-weight:bolder;
		text-align:right;
		color:#666666;
		}
	.divMenu{
		position:absolute;
		top:274px;
		left:0;
		height:30px;
		width:1000px;
		border-bottom-style:groove;
		border-bottom-width:1px;
		border-bottom-color:#bcbec0;
		padding-top:2px;
		padding-bottom:4px;
		padding-left:0px;
		padding-right:0px;
		z-index:0;	
		}
	/**************************MENU TOP*********************************/
	#menutop{
		padding: 0px;
		margin: 0px;
		height: 30px;
		/*width: 1000px;*/
		/*position: relative;*/
		font-family:Verdana, Geneva, Arial, Helvetica, sans-serif;
		font-size:10pt;
		font-weight:bolder;
		text-align:center;
		vertical-align:middle;
		color:#666666;
		}
	#menutop a {
		display: block;
		/*text-indent: -900%;*/
		position: relative;
		top:3px;
		outline: none;
		text-decoration:none;
		color:#666666;
		}
	#menutop a:visited {
		color:#666666;
		}
	#menutop a:hover {
		background-position: center;
		background: url(../img/buta.gif) no-repeat;
		color:#ffffff;
		}
	#menutop .but {
		width: 164px;
		height: 26px;
		background: url(../img/butna.gif) no-repeat;
		}
	/**************************MENU LEFT*********************************/
	#menuleft{
		padding: 0px;
		margin: 0px;
		height: 30px;
		font-family:Verdana, Geneva, Arial, Helvetica, sans-serif;
		font-size:10pt;
		font-weight:bolder;
		text-align:center;
		vertical-align:middle;
		color:#666666;
		}
	#menuleft a {
		display: block;
		position: relative;
		top:3px;
		outline: none;
		text-decoration:none;
		color:#666666;
		}
	#menuleft a:visited {
		color:#666666;
		}
	#menuleft a:hover {
		background-position: center;
		background: url(../img/butSma.gif) no-repeat;
		}
	#menuleft .but {
		width: 26px;
		height: 26px;
		background: url(../img/butSmna.gif) no-repeat;
		}
	#menuleft .txt:hover{
		color:#628eb1;
		background: none;
		}

	/**************************MENU TABLE PRODUC*********************************/
	#menutable{
		padding: 0px;
		margin: 0px;
		font-family:Verdana, Geneva, Arial, Helvetica, sans-serif;
		font-size:11pt;
		font-weight:bolder;
		text-align:right;
		vertical-align:middle;
		color:#666666;
		}
	#menutable a {
		display: block;
		position: relative;
		top:3px;
		outline: none;
		text-decoration:none;
		color:#666666;
		}
	#menutable a:visited {
		color:#666666;
		}
	#menutable a:hover {
		background-position: center;
		background: url(../img/butSma.gif) no-repeat;
		}
	#menutable .but {
		width: 26px;
		height: 26px;
		background: url(../img/butSmna.gif) no-repeat;
		}
	#menutable .tdTxt{
		padding:5px;
		border-bottom-style:dotted;
		border-bottom-width:1px;
		border-bottom-color:#bcbec0;
		text-align:left;
		font-size:10pt;
		font-weight:normal;
		color:#000000;
		}
	#menutable .txt:hover{
		color:#628eb1;
		background: none;
		}

	.tdMenu{
		width:144px;
		background:center;
		background-image:url(../img/butna.gif);
		background-repeat:no-repeat;
		margin:0;
		padding:2px;
		font-family:Verdana, Geneva, Arial, Helvetica, sans-serif;
		font-size:10pt;
		font-weight:bolder;
		text-align:center;
		vertical-align:middle;
		color:#666666;
		}
	.tdTableBut{
		width:28px;
		height:40px;
		background:center;
		background-image:url(../img/butSmna.gif);
		background-repeat:no-repeat;
		margin:0;
		padding:2px;
		vertical-align:middle;
	}
	.tdTable{
		width:270px;
		height:40px;
		border-bottom-style:dotted;
		border-bottom-width:1px;
		border-bottom-color:#bcbec0;
		margin:0px;
		padding:0px;
		text-align:right;
		font-family:Verdana, Geneva, Arial, Helvetica, sans-serif;
		font-size:11pt;
		font-weight:bolder;
		color:#666666;
	}
	.tdTableWide{
		width:570px;
		height:40px;
		border-bottom-style:dotted;
		border-bottom-width:1px;
		border-bottom-color:#bcbec0;
		margin:0px;
		padding:0px;
		text-align:right;
		font-family:Verdana, Geneva, Arial, Helvetica, sans-serif;
		font-size:11pt;
		font-weight:bolder;
		color:#666666;
	}
	/********* table gidrant details*************************/
	#tableDet{
		width:250px;
		height:350px;
		margin:0px;
		padding:0px;
		text-align:left;
		font-family:Verdana, Geneva, Arial, Helvetica, sans-serif;
		font-size:11pt;
		color:#666666;
		}
	#tableDet .trWhite{
		border-bottom-style:dotted;
		border-bottom-width:1px;
		border-bottom-color:#bcbec0;
		}
	#tableDet .trGray{
		border-bottom-style:dotted;
		border-bottom-width:1px;
		border-bottom-color:#bcbec0;
		background-color:#c8c8c8;
		color:#444444;
		}

	.pTxt{
		font-family:Verdana, Geneva, Arial, Helvetica, sans-serif;
		font-size:10pt;
		text-align:left;
		text-indent:0;
		color:#000000;
		}
	.title{
		font-family:Verdana, Geneva, Arial, Helvetica, sans-serif;
		font-size:13pt;
		text-align:left;
		color:#628eb1;
		}